On 2022/09/05 16:09, Tao Liu wrote:
> Patch [1] enables kmem to print task context if the given virtual
> address is a vmalloced stack.
> 
> This patch handles the same issue except the given address is
> physical address.

If we do this, it would be better to support a kernel without
CONFIG_VMAP_STACK, too.  Any reason not to support?

crash> sys
       KERNEL: vmlinux-3.10.0-957.el7.x86_64
...
crash> kmem ffff88007cfdbf80
     PID: 1
COMMAND: "systemd"
    TASK: ffff88007cfd0000  [THREAD_INFO: ffff88007cfd8000]
     CPU: 0
   STATE: TASK_INTERRUPTIBLE

       PAGE       PHYSICAL      MAPPING       INDEX CNT FLAGS
ffffea0001f3f6c0 7cfdb000                0        0  0 1fffff00000000

crash> kmem 7cfdbf80
       PAGE       PHYSICAL      MAPPING       INDEX CNT FLAGS
ffffea0001f3f6c0 7cfdb000                0        0  0 1fffff00000000
